Morning all. (Well it still is here ) Working through my first submit of the day. I made scrambled eggs with mushrooms, green onions, and spinach for breakfast, the first time I've had eggs in about 6 years. Plus had some Veggie Bacon Strips, which were excellent. Not sure why I never tried those earlier.

Did a Nutritional Typing test last week, and realized I wasn't getting enough protein in my diet. I can only eat so much tofu, soy milk, soy protein powder, and cheese, so added eggs back in.

Cleo, any good suggestions on other veggy protein sources? No way I will add meat/chicken/fish back in, but maybe there are some good veggie ones I'm missing.

My problem is my sugar starting to go up, and weight having a hard time coming off, cause I'm eating too many carbs...even veggie carbs. I have found increasing my protein, decreasing my carbs, it is stopping the cravings, and my sugar is getting more normal. Not an atkins, but more like 50% protein per meal, instead of about 10% or so I was doing.

Are you Vegan, or a lactose / ovo-lactose vegetarian? I was strictly lactose, but started adding the ovo too.

When I was a veggie I kept eggs in my diet as well.

Raw nuts is a good source as well. We mix our favorites all together in plastic cereal container. Makes it easy to grab a handful or two a day.

Also, protein bars can help plus they feed a chocolate craving at the same time, if you find the right ones.

You have probably heard of this but if not, Moosewood Cookbook absolutely rocks for vegetarian recipes.
